Abstract

The case here tries to sensitise its readers towards what is one of the largest privatized and yet highly unorganised retail store formats in the world. The case in question talks about how the backward integration and adoption of set standards by the small time retailers can in turn benefit the end consumer tangibly as well as intangibly. Our research, first entailed, outlining the methodology and the singling out the markets of Greater Ghaziabad catchment areas in Uttar Pradesh for our research. The study is diversified according to various parameters like the age of business, & the customers these businesses are targeting. All in all the chapter tries to communicate to its readers, the importance of understanding the dynamics of doing business in rural retail sector of India, whether relatively organised or unorganised.
